## Deployment

Deploying the Hayrake gateway is pretty painless these days. Build the container, push it to the internal registry, then roll it out to the field relay boxes via the Cropline orchestrator. Telemetry from tractors buffers locally, so a few minutes of downtime during rollout is fine. Just don't deploy during harvest-season peak hours — the ops folks in Millbrant will notice. Once the new build is up, confirm it picked up these configuration values.

config for kafof-bawef:
holath:
  log_level: debug
  metrics_host: metrics.holath.qorvelsys.internal
  pin: 2191
  pool_size: 32

Ticket BP-88: Mailrake bounce processor failing on staging. DSN parsing fine; SMTP callback rejects with auth error. Cause: env file copied from dev without the provider credential. Reviewer, confirm BOUNCE_RETRY_MAX=5 and MAILRAKE_MODE=staging are intact, then append the credential as the next line of the file.

env line for fafof-fahag: LEDGER_TOKEN5=f8790

MEMO — Board of Brightvale Foods

Quick heads-up before Thursday's session: we're trimming the marketing budget by 18% for the back half of the year. The Lumaflake campaign underperformed in the Teston region, and frankly we overspent on sponsorships that didn't move the needle. Dana Whitcomb's team has already reworked the channel mix, leaning on retail partnerships instead of broad media buys. Nobody on staff is affected. Savings get redirected per the roadmap below. Full context on where this fits follows.

board note of bawep-tajef: Queniusek Systems plans to raise the Quenvan list price by 53.1 percent in March. The pricing group signed off on a budget of $176.4 million for Project Drueth. The renewal with Casionix Partners closes at $142.5 million a year, 8.3 percent below the last contract. Project Fraax slips by six weeks because of the tooling delay.

Subject: Inkwell markdown pipeline 5.1 deployed

On-call: the Inkwell rendering pipeline is now on 5.1 in production. Changes: sanitizer runs before the table parser, footnote rendering is cached per document, and the fallback plain-text path no longer strips headings. If render latency alarms fire, roll back via the standard script — it handles cache invalidation. Known issue: nested blockquotes over six levels render flat. The deployment trace token follows.

build token for hawep-kageg: htk14_558814e2114cc7